There are barrels available but it was more for the availability of the components. I can get new and unfired brass cases relatively cheap, projos are readily available and since it's going to be a rental gun, I need to make sure that we have plenty of components available to keep customers happy. As for auto ejecting, it's because of the conversion. We could probably make some new ejectors but they come right out with a flat head.

Did they turn a complete new barrel or use an older bofors barrel?

I would think finding a blank large enough for the carriage/breach would be tough. I could see the carriage adapters but the Breach to barrel interface seems like it would be tough unless a 40mm bofors barrel just happened to have the same thread size as the breach.
Link Posted: 7/23/2018 4:11:50 PM EDT
[#6]
We found a 40mm Bofors barrel and had it turned to mirror the I.D. of the factory 57mm barrel.
